Molding Painting in Wilmington, NC
Molding painting services involve applying paint and finishes to interior or exterior moldings, trim, baseboards, crown molding, and other decorative woodwork. This service enhances the appearance of a property by providing a fresh, polished look to architectural details, whether in living rooms, hallways, or exteriors. Projects can range from touch-ups and repainting to complete color changes or refinishing of existing moldings, helping to update and maintain the aesthetic appeal of a home or commercial space.
Homeowners typically seek molding painting services to improve interior design, cover up damage or wear, or match new paint schemes. Before requesting this service, property owners should consider the type of molding material, the current condition of the surfaces, and the desired color or finish. Understanding the scope of work, including whether repairs or surface preparation are needed, can ensure the project meets expectations and results in a cohesive, attractive look for the property.

Molding Painting Questions
What types of molding can be painted? Various moldings such as crown, baseboard, and decorative trims can be painted to match interior or exterior decor.
Is priming necessary before painting molding? Priming helps ensure better adhesion and a smooth finish, especially on raw or stained wood surfaces.
Can molding be painted over existing paint? Yes, existing painted moldings can be refreshed with a new coat of paint, provided the surface is clean and in good condition.
What finishes are available for painted molding? Common finishes include matte, satin, semi-gloss, and high-gloss, depending on the desired look and durability needs.
